Is your fridge getting way too cold? That can be annoying and even ruin your food. Here are three simple reasons why it might be happening:
Thermostat Trouble: The thermostat is like the fridge’s temperature controller. If it’s acting up, your fridge might get too chilly. Check the settings or get it fixed if needed.
Blocked Air Vents: Inside your fridge, there are little openings that let cold air flow. If they get blocked by food or stuff, some parts of your fridge might freeze. Make sure these vents are clear.
Broken Temperature Control: Sometimes, the fridge’s temperature control can break. This can make your fridge colder than you want. Test the controls and ask a pro if something’s wrong.

The refrigerator or freezer is completely unresponsive and does not turn on.
Possible Cause: This could be due to a tripped circuit breaker, a blown fuse, a disconnected power cord, or a malfunctioning electrical outlet.
The refrigerator or freezer is not cooling to the temperature you have set.
Possible Cause: Potential causes include a dirty or clogged condenser coil, a malfunctioning thermostat, or inadequate airflow around the appliance.
The refrigerator or freezer is running, but the temperature inside remains warmer than it should.
Possible Cause: Causes may include a faulty compressor, a refrigerant leak, a damaged evaporator fan, or a blocked air vent.
Ice or frost accumulates inside the freezer, potentially obstructing airflow.
Possible Cause: Common causes are a faulty defrost timer, a malfunctioning defrost heater, or a damaged freezer door seal (gasket).
Unusual and loud noises are coming from the refrigerator.
Possible Cause: Noises can result from a malfunctioning condenser fan, a worn-out evaporator fan motor, or ice buildup in the freezer.
The freezer compartment maintains a low temperature, but the refrigerator section remains too warm.
Possible Cause: A common cause is a malfunctioning damper control, which regulates the airflow between the two compartments.
Frost and ice accumulate in the freezer and refrigerator compartments over time.
Possible Cause: This can happen due to a faulty defrost timer, a malfunctioning defrost heater, or a defective temperature sensor.
The ice maker is not producing ice as expected.
Possible Cause: Possible causes include a clogged water inlet valve, a defective ice maker module, or low water pressure.
The ice maker produces too much ice, causing it to overflow.
Possible Cause: This can occur if the ice maker’s water inlet valve fails to shut off properly or if the ice maker module is malfunctioning.
Items stored in the refrigerator section are freezing when they shouldn’t.
Possible Cause: Potential causes include a faulty thermostat or an issue with the damper control that regulates cold airflow.
The refrigerator’s compressor runs non-stop without cycling off.
Possible Cause: This can be caused by a malfunctioning thermostat, dirty condenser coils, or a refrigerant leak.
The interior light of the refrigerator is not illuminating when the door is opened.
Possible Cause: This may be due to a burnt-out light bulb, a defective door switch, or a wiring issue.
The refrigerator’s water dispenser is not dispensing water.
Possible Cause: Causes may include a clogged water filter, a malfunctioning water inlet valve, or a frozen water line.

Is your refrigerator displaying an error code? New and modern refrigerators have built in diagnostic systems in them. If your refrigerator finds, sees, or detects a fault or error in the system, it will show an error or fault code. When an error code is displayed, your refrigerator is telling you a specific fault. If the error or fault is not fixable by you, it will require a skilled and professional repair technician to diagnose the problem and fix it.
There are many refrigerator and freezer different makes and model numbers with digital displays so if you see an error code write down what is flashing or displaying and if not able to identify the problem yourself provide the information to the technician prior the schedule to give the repair person possible problem cause.
Cleaning your fridge helps it to function better. Warm refrigerator temperatures might be a result of overloading your fridge.
Throw out leftovers and expired items. Clean the spills and messes when they happen. Ensure that you put canned food into a container before storing in the fridge, open cans should not be stored in the refrigerator. Same rule applies to cups and plates.
Opening the door often causes hot air to enter your fridge from outside, therefore making it work overtime to cool down again. Make it a habit to keep the door of the fridge closed when you don’t really need it. This will help your refrigerator to last longer and cut down electric bills.
The refrigerator temperature should be set 0 - 5 ° c to keep your food safe and prevent spoilage

The refrigerator is a huge investment and an essential requirement. This household appliance can last as many as 10 to 15 years if you decide buy a high-quality model, but eventually each refrigerator will reach the end of its service life.
You need to take some factor into account when making your decision.
First is the age of your refrigerator, the older your refrigerator is, the better the benefit of replacing it. The cost of repair, some repairs might be minimal, which will make your refrigerator last a few more years, and in other cases, some repairs are very costly, and it is probably best to spend the money on a new refrigerator.
If it is an outdated refrigerator that uses old refrigerants that are not environmentally friendly and comprehensive to fix , it will be better to replace it with a new and much more efficient model.
You can find comfort in the fact that today’s models use less energy than older refrigerators if you have to upgrade your refrigerator and, because they’re on all the time , a new one can save you cash in the long run.

1. Clean the Condenser Coils: The condenser coils, located at the back or bottom of the fridge, dissipate heat to keep the appliance cool. Dust and debris can accumulate on these coils, hindering their ability to release heat effectively. Regularly clean the coils using a vacuum or a brush to remove any buildup.
2. Check the Door Seals: Hot weather can cause rubber door seals to expand, compromising their effectiveness. Inspect the door seals for any signs of wear or damage and ensure they create a tight seal when closed. Replace damaged seals to maintain proper temperature control inside the fridge.
3. Keep the Fridge Full: A well-stocked fridge retains cold air better than an empty one. Fill empty spaces with jugs of water or other items to help stabilize the temperature and reduce energy consumption.
4. Maintain Proper Ventilation: Ensure that there is ample space around the fridge for air to circulate. Avoid placing it next to heat-emitting appliances or in direct sunlight, as this can cause the fridge to work harder to maintain cool temperatures.
5. Monitor Temperature Settings: Check and adjust the temperature settings as needed to keep your fridge at the ideal temperature range, typically between 35-38°F (1-3°C). Avoid opening the door frequently, as it allows warm air to enter and affects the cooling process.
A: The recommended temperature for a fridge is between 35-38°F (1-3°C), while the freezer should be set to 0°F (-18°C). These temperatures help maintain food safety and freshness.
A: To prevent odors, ensure all food items are properly sealed and stored. Clean spills promptly and regularly remove expired or spoiled food. You can also place an open box of baking soda or a bowl of activated charcoal in the fridge to absorb odors.
A: The lifespan of a fridge freezer can vary depending on factors such as brand, model, usage, and maintenance. On average, a well-maintained fridge freezer can last between 10-15 years. Regular maintenance and prompt repairs can extend its lifespan.
